摘要 1,219,418. Continuous casting. MONSANTO CO. 4 Dec., 1967 [6 Dec., 1966], No. 55120/67. Heading B3F. [Also in Division C1] Fibres, filaments or films, including rods, ribbons or wires are formed by streaming a melt through an orifice, e.g. by extrusion through a ruby die 18, and stabilizing the stream against break-up before solidification (by forming a thin film on it by reaction, decomposition or deposition as described in Specification 1,153,577) and also applying a deceleration, e.g. by passage through a denser or counterflowing atmosphere or by applying an electrostatic field or by interposition of a plate 36, at a position downstream of a point where if applied it would disrupt the stream and upstream of a point where tensile forces would break it up if the deceleration were not applied. The melt may be non-metal (see Division C1). In the spinning apparatus shown, material such as Pb-Sn is melted, e.g. under vacuum, by resistance heaters 20 or an induction heater, in a chamber 16 and the temperature monitored by a thermocouple 24. By operation of a valve 26 the chamber may be alternately evacuated and supplied with argon to extrude the melt controllably, through a 100 micron orifice 20 in the ruby jewel 18, into a preevacuated glass column 27, supplied with a spin gas mixture of helium or nitrogen (with a small volume of oxygen) through holes 32 in a ring 30, to form a stabilizing oxide film on the stream. During evacuation (through a connection 34), the bottom of the glass column 27 is temporarily closed and extrusion may start before the introduction of the spin gas. The flow rate of the oxygen into the column may be varied. The stream is decelerated by impact on the collection plate 36 which is adjustable vertically and may be tilted. The continuity of the stream between the melt crucible 10 and the plate 36 may be monitored for determination of spinning conditions by a simple electrical continuity testing circuit, Fig. 3 (not shown). As described in Specification 1,197,972, to avoid undue surface expansion of the stream and subsequent weakening of the stabilizing film, the die orifice 20 may be a short bore, i.e. it may have a minimum cross-sectional area extending over a length less than five times the major dimension of that cross-section. As described in Specification 1,210,920, the drag on the stream due to the spin gas is controlled to prevent it causing deviation of the stream from moving up the stream.
